Understanding the Diamond Face Shape
Before diving into glasses styles, it’s important to identify whether you truly have a diamond-shaped face. Here are the main characteristics:
- Forehead: Narrower than the cheeks
- Cheekbones: Wide and high
- Jawline: Tapers to a defined or pointed chin
- Face Length: Usually longer than it is wide
This face shape is often described as angular and well-defined. Think of celebrities like Megan Fox, Scarlett Johansson, and Johnny Depp — all known for their diamond-shaped faces.
What to Look for in Glasses for a Diamond Face Shape
The goal when choosing Diamond Face Shape Glasses is to balance your facial structure and highlight your best features — especially those beautiful cheekbones. Here’s what to keep in mind:
1. Soften the Angles
Diamond-shaped faces can appear sharp and angular, so glasses with soft curves can help create a more balanced look.
2. Highlight the Eyes
Frames that draw attention to your eyes, such as upswept or bold brow styles, help offset the narrow forehead.
3. Avoid Adding Width to Cheekbones
Since your cheekbones are already the widest part of your face, steer clear of glasses that sit too wide or emphasize this area too much.
Best Glasses Styles for Diamond Face Shape
Now that you know what to look for, here are the best frame styles to flatter a diamond-shaped face:
1. Oval Glasses
Oval frames are one of the most recommended styles for diamond faces. They offer gentle curves that soften the face’s angles while maintaining balance.
Why they work:
They reduce harsh lines and draw focus to the eyes instead of the cheekbones.
2. Cat-Eye Glasses
If you love a touch of vintage glamour, cat-eye glasses are perfect. Their upswept corners help lift the face visually and make the forehead appear broader.
Why they work:
They balance the pointed chin and highlight the upper face without making the cheeks look wider.
3. Rimless and Semi-Rimless Glasses
These minimalist styles are ideal if you prefer subtlety and elegance. Rimless frames provide an airy look that doesn’t add bulk to your face.
Why they work:
They don’t overpower your facial structure and keep the focus on your natural features.
4. Browline Glasses
With a bold upper frame and lighter lower rim, browline glasses bring attention to the eyes and brow area, which helps create the illusion of a broader forehead.
Why they work:
They create balance between the top and bottom halves of your face.
Styles to Avoid
While fashion is always personal, certain styles can exaggerate the angles of a diamond-shaped face rather than balance them.
✘ Narrow or Thin Frames
These can make the cheekbones look even wider and the face appear longer.
✘ Oversized Geometric Frames
Big square or rectangular glasses may overwhelm your features and create a bulky look.
✘ Heavy Bottom Frames
Frames that emphasize the lower half of the face may draw unwanted attention to the chin and jawline.
How to Choose the Right Glasses Online
Shopping online for glasses can be overwhelming, but with a few simple tips, you can make a confident choice.
✓ Use Virtual Try-On Tools
Most eyewear retailers now offer virtual try-on features using your webcam or a photo. Take advantage of this to see how different styles look on your face.
✓ Know Your Measurements
Check the frame width, lens height, and temple length. Compare with your current glasses to find a comfortable fit.
✓ Read Reviews
Look for customer photos and feedback. People with similar face shapes can give insight into how certain styles may look on you.
✓ Check Return Policies
In case a frame doesn’t suit you, ensure that the seller offers free returns or exchanges.
